President of Uzbekistan Visits Artificial Intelligence Laboratory in Namangan

New center combines research, startups, and applied AI developments for regional digitalization

Shavkat Mirziyoyev familiarized himself with the work of the new artificial intelligence research laboratory at Namangan State Technical University during his visit to the Namangan region of Uzbekistan. The center was established as part of the state program for regional digitalization and the introduction of IT technologies into key sectors of the economy.

The laboratory is designed as a comprehensive research platform, integrating data analysis, robotics, and bionics. Its structure includes specialized units for big data processing, multimedia AI laboratories, and a startup accelerator for commercializing developments.

Particular attention is paid to applied areas — environmental monitoring, agrotechnologies, "smart" transport, and automation of production processes. This approach allows testing solutions not only in an academic environment but also in real conditions of regional management.

During the visit, startup projects developed with the participation of AI specialists, already integrated into the system of local authorities, were presented. This emphasizes the transition from research to the practical application of digital solutions in management.

The President of Uzbekistan held a meeting with young developers and researchers, discussing the development of technological initiatives. Following the visit, the importance of scaling such centers as an element of personnel training and accelerating the digital transformation of regions was noted.
